I bought this 2 months ago . It is everything they say it is .Went thru Steve Smith at VACAWAY and it was shipped to me free from California in less than a week. Now ordering the brush and weight system for hard surface . Cost for me was $2199 delivered - that was w/o the spray system. It can be added for$500 at anytime . Same goes for brush and weights. I only have 1 regret - that I didn't do it sooner !!! Awesome in every way. I am an exclusive padmethod cleaning biz. This machine rocks.

This unit is new to Kleen Kuip but I feel it's manufacturer is totally dedicated to this method of cleaning and has impressed us in the past. So far I like what I see and the Orbot handles with ease.
 
They have also offered a new weight system for making it more effective on hard surfaces such as hardwood sanding or marble finishing etc,.
 
I will be testing these weights next week and will let you all know.
 
I sold two units the first week and can report that I have added 2 very happy customers to the KK family. I will have both do a testimonial on a video for you. One of these buyers uses OP exclusively and claims to do $200,000 in sales per year by himself with no helpers. His charge is 49 cents per/sq. ft
 
How many steamers with a truckmount investment can top that?
 
The price for the Orbot as of today is $4,150.00 which is less than $4.00 per day over a three year period.
